Oskar Blues, Can'd Aid Ship 66,000 Cans of Water to Hurricane-stricken Florida

10/13/2018, 4:15:46 AM
In response to the destruction caused this week by Hurricane Michael, which so far has killed at least 17 people, Oskar Blues switched off the beer lines at its cannery for six hours on Friday and canned 66,000 cans of clean water to be donated to relief efforts in Florida. Founded in Lyons, Oskar Blues Brewery understands exactly how devastating a natural disaster can be for a community. So, too, does Can'd Aid, a Longmont based nonprofit supporting acts of "do-goodery," that formed as a result of the historic flooding in 2013 .

The butterfly effect has ants playing defence

10/13/2018, 6:16:56 AM
A wonder of nature is playing out in the sleepy suburbs of Melbourne's north, where a rare butterfly has found an unlikely protector. ✔ Much of the buttefly's habitat has been cleared for agriculture or swallowed up by urban growth ✔ Because of its total reliance on a single plant species and one genus of ants, the Eltham copper butterfly clings on in a just a couple of dozen colonies, mainly upon islands of remnant bush, surrounded by a sea of houses or farms ✔ until you're left with nothing that naturally occurred there
